How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Eastmorland?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Eastmorland Studio Apartments | $1,392 | $950 | $1,705 |
Eastmorland 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,739 | $678 | $2,465 |
Eastmorland 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,038 | $1,050 | $3,695 |
Eastmorland 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,275 | $1,300 | $3,725 |
